The next James Bond is a 'veteran', says producer

James Bond producer Michael G. Wilson has told fans not to expect a young Bond, calling the character a "veteran".

Kate Harrold

Kate Harrold

In all likelihood, the next James Bond film is probably several years away but in the month’s since Daniel Craig’s swan song No Time To Die released, rumours have been ramping up about what that next film might look like. Fans want to know who will be taking on the role of cinema’s most famous spy and whilst Idris Elba’s name has been thrown around, the actor isn’t so sure.

What we do know is that the Bond franchise will continue to evolve, building upon the emotional sensitivity established in Craig’s Bond tenure. One thing that won’t change though is Bond’s age.

During an event at London’s BFI, Bond producer Michael G. Wilson explained (via Deadline), that James Bond is a “veteran,” and not “some kid out of high school,” so don’t expect to see a younger James Bond.

Wilson explained, “We've tried looking at younger people in the past but trying to visualise it doesn't work. Remember, Bond's already a veteran. He's had some experience. He's a person who has been through the wars, so to speak. He's probably been in the SAS or something. He isn't some kid out of high school that you can bring in and start off. That's why it works for a thirty-something."
